Hangzhou, the capital of Zhejiang province in eastern China, is renowned for its historical and cultural heritage, scenic landscapes, and economic significance. The city is famous for West Lake, a UNESCO World Heritage site, known for its picturesque beauty and classical Chinese gardens. Hangzhou has a rich history dating back over 2,200 years and was once the southern terminus of the Grand Can...

Hong Kong New Territory Walk Tour, Tsing Yi is an island in the New Territories of Hong Kong, characterized by its blend of residential, industrial, and recreational areas. Tsing Yi Town, together with Kwai Chung Town, is part of Tsuen Wan New Town in the Kwai Tsing District in the New Territories. Although Tsing Yi Island is a de facto outlying island, it is not accordingly included in the Isl...

Hong Kong Kowloon Walled City Park, Kowloon Walled City Park is a historical and cultural park in Kowloon City, Hong Kong, built on the site of the former Kowloon Walled City. Opened in 1995, the park features traditional Chinese architecture, landscaped gardens, and relics that celebrate its unique past. Once a densely populated and ungoverned settlement, the Walled City was known for its maze...

Riding a sampan to dine at the Jumbo Floating Restaurant must have been quite an experience. Sadly, the Jumbo Floating Restaurant has been closed and moved from its original location. (On 14 June 2022, the Jumbo Floating Restaurant was towed out of Hong Kong to Cambodia to await a new operator. While transiting in the South China Sea, it experienced bad weather and capsized near the Paracel Islands on 19 June 2022. Its operator has denied describing it as sunk.)
